In this first novel of a new trilogy, Lovely takes her fans outside the church and explores the inner workings of a family--the lives, loves, and scandals of a modern-day dynasty.

Introducing the Livingstons, an affluent African-American family in Atlanta, Georgia. They own Taste of Soul, a fast casual soul food restaurant. The Livingstons are trying to ensure that they remain profitable in these tough economic times. Siblings Malcolm and Toussaint have been competitive since their youth. With the chance to take the company to the next level, each brother has a different plan. Whose will be the winning idea?

The family that cooks together stays together. The Livingstons are one such family. They own a chain of soul food restaurants, Taste of Soul. Though they are a tightly knit, loving family, they are no strangers to drama.
